Logistics That Protect Margin

Plan the battery customs paperwork at the same time as the order, not when the goods are on the water. A missing document costs more in demurrage than the entire freight saving from a cheap forwarder.

What to Fix Before Approving Battery

Where possible, tie part of the battery payment to inspection against the written spec. It focuses attention on the numbers rather than on the relationship.

Ask any factory for the same battery sample twice, three months apart. If the second sample drifts, the production line is running without statistical control and your reviews will drift with it. Consistency over time is a more useful signal than a single good sample.

Quality Control in Practice

The cheapest quality control step is a retained sample. Keeping three sealed units from every battery batch costs almost nothing and turns any dispute into a simple comparison instead of an argument over photographs.

The defect rate that matters is the one your customer experiences, not the one the factory reports. Bridge that gap by inspecting the way a customer would open the box, not the way a line worker packs it.
